About this ebook

This is the tale of Stinkerton McPoo.

The finest of dogs and the friendliest too.

Now you may be asking, “But what’s with that name?”

To call a dog Stinkerton seems like a shame.

She’s wonderful company, except for, alas…

Stinkerton suffers from terrible gas!


A wonderful rhyming adventure about a lovable, mischievous, and more-than-slightly-gassy dog named Stinkerton McPoo. In this hilarious and beautifully illustrated book, Stinkerton runs off to have her own adventure, but before long, she soon finds herself in trouble with the entire village chasing after her! How will Stinkerton manage to escape and find her way back home?

About the author

Stephen Hodgkinson-Soto lives in the East Midlands of England. He has been with his husband Antonio since 2009. Having met while living in California, they moved to the UK in 2017. They have two children, and two dogs. Fia, the inspiration behind this book series, and although lovely company, is also known as “Stinkerton McPoo” - and for good reason!

While new to writing, Stephen has had the idea for the Stinkerton McPoo books for a while, and ready to explore new creative outlets, he has decided to pursue his dream of becoming a best-selling author.

Most of all, Stephen wants to help create those special moments for families that can only come from story time. He hopes you enjoy reading this book as much as he has enjoyed writing it, and he’s excited to announce his plans for many more books in the Stinkerton McPoo series.
